About this property

Best of both worlds! Surrounded by nature and still close to town, pet-friendly

Solitude Ridge, the name says it all.

In 15 minutes you can rideshare to vibrant downtown Asheville with some of the country's best breweries. Afterwards, you can grill and relax on your completely private deck.
After quiet morning coffee in a rocking chair on the front porch, you could wander into the wild forest before grabbing breakfast in Black Mountain 10 minutes away.

This simple home is the perfect place for your party of 7 to relax and enjoy the natural beauty of authentic Appalachia.

About the Space
Ample comfortable outdoor seating and plenty of space to lounge around, do yoga, and read a good book. Board games, books and Roku sticks to enjoy by the gas fireplace and a fully equipped workspace for those who need to take care of business.

Guest access
You'll have the whole house and backyard, as well as walking access (up the steep and wild mountain) to our little flat spot with a view at the top of our two acres.

Of Note:
The steep, paved driveway can add an exciting element for those who enjoy solitude in nature! Unfortunately it cannot accommodate guests with RVs or large trailers.

There are stairs inside the home that are not suitable for young children, as they have a railing that children could easily climb through. We do not recommend that families with toddlers book our property. Thank you for understanding.
